Puppies get loose in Pennsylvania Turnpike crash
Police had to round up some puppies after the van that was transporting them hit a truck on the Pennsylvania Turnpike in Montgomery County.
The crash happened around 4:30 a.m. Wednesday in the eastbound lanes between Willow Grove and Bensalem.
Police tell KYW-TV the impact caused several of the dogs to get out of their cages.
The eastbound lanes were closed while authorities rounded up the puppies.
Two people were taken to a hospital. Their conditions are not known.
It is not known if any of the puppies were injured.
